Agenda Caption: Public hearing, presentation, possible action, and discussion on an
ordinance amending the Comprehensive Land Use Plan from Single Family - Medium
Density to Office for 2.76 acres located at 1103 Rock Prairie Road, generally located
between Rio Grande Drive and Westchester Avenue.
Recommendation(s): The Planning and Zoning Commission unanimously recommended
approval of the item at their November 1, 2007, meeting. Staff also recommends approval.
Summary: The subject request was analyzed as follows:
1. Changed or changing conditions in the subject area or the City: The subject
property has an existing Land Use Plan designation of Single Family - Medium
Density. The property was zoned for multi-family in 1988, which was appropriate for
the development of an assisted living facility at the time. The property was
subdivided in April 2007 from the 7.5 acre lot in which the assisted living facility was
developed. The other adjacent properties are developed as a nursing home to the
east and a place of worship to the west.
2. Compatibility with the remainder of the Comprehensive Plan: The proposed
Amendment would help achieve the City's objective to promote the use of vacant
land where infrastructure and services are readily available. The Office designation
would be compatible with the existing surrounding developed uses as it would allow
for the development of office or medical uses that are complimentary to them as well
as the College Station Medical Center campus and surrounding uses. The subject
property has 200' of frontage on Rock Prairie Road, a Major Arterial on the City's
Thoroughfare Plan. Access to the property is obtained through an existing access
easement and driveway shared with the properties to the east and to the north. This
frontage and access environment is not conducive to the development of single
family uses.
